Lengthening days in Nara-shi through March 2017

Daylight lengthens through March 2017 in Nara-shi, Japan, moving from 11h 25m on the first days to 12h 30m on the last — a swing of about 65 minutes. Day length shifts by about 15 minutes each week.

The earliest sunrise falls at 05:45 on March 31 and the latest at 06:26 on March 1, while sunset ranges from 17:52 on March 1 to 18:16 on March 31.

March also brings the spring equinox around March 20, a turning point in the year's light. The longest day of the month is March 31 at 12h 30m, the shortest March 1 at 11h 25m. Handy for photographers, early risers, travellers and anyone timing their day to the light in Nara-shi.

What is the difference between sunrise and sunset?

Sunrise is the moment the sun's top edge first appears above the horizon in the morning; sunset is when it disappears below the horizon in the evening. The gap between them is the day's length, which shifts gradually through the year.

Are the sunrise and sunset times for Nara-shi accurate?

Times are calculated from the location's exact latitude, longitude and time zone using standard astronomical algorithms, accurate to about a minute. Local terrain such as hills or tall buildings can slightly shift when the sun actually appears or disappears.
